Title: Restinga Pathways.
Location: Restinga de Jurubatiba National Park, Rio de Janeiro state, Brazil.
Description: The dark coloration of the water is attributed to the high concentration of humic substances. Small water flows can be observed across different sections of the restinga, resulting from subtle variations in topography. These micro-relief differences facilitate water movement between areas, forming natural pathways as illustrated in the image.
